Thriving in Shade: Indoor Plants That Love Low Light
Not all homes enjoy bright light. But that doesn’t mean you have to give up indoor gardening. Some of the best indoor plants for low light include peace lilies, ferns, cast iron plants, and philodendrons. These indoor favourites are perfect for dim corners, north-facing rooms, and rooms lacking windows.
They make it possible to add natural décor even in dark offices. Their ability to photosynthesize in low-light conditions makes them ideal for apartment owners who want greenery without special arrangements.
Plants That Are Hard to Kill
Most people have faced the disappointment of a plant turning brown. Thankfully, some species are tough enough that it’s hard to harm them. These hard-to-kill plants include aloe vera, spider plants, rubber plants, and jade plants.
They resist common problems like extra moisture, low humidity, and shifts in conditions. Even after weeks without attention, they recover. These are ideal for beginners, since you can ignore them briefly and still return to find them thriving.

Plants That Fit Every Room and All Homes
Every room can benefit from greenery. Houseplants for any space can be picked based on size, sunlight levels, and humidity tolerance. For example, ferns love bathrooms, while succulents are perfect for bright windows.
Tall plants like fiddle leaf figs or snake plants are great for living rooms, while smaller ones like lucky bamboo or ZZ plants fit nicely for desks and nightstands. Their resilience means you’re not restricted by square footage or lighting availability.

Simple Choices: Easy Plants to Grow Indoors Without Stress
The joy of plants is greater when you don’t need to worry about care. Easy indoor plants like pothos, peace lilies, Chinese evergreens, and sansevierias grow well with minimal care.
They don’t need special food or complicated schedules. Just indirect light, infrequent watering, and leaf dusting are enough to keep them thriving.
